after using the VLC for years i noticed some time ago that there a tab on the right next to the sound volume control (red recangle) with which the replay speed of a recorded video can be either slowed down or fastened up. i marked it here with a blue arrow. it's at setting "1x" as default. when you click on it a slidebar opens and you can slide the tab to slower or faster. when you adjust the replay speed slow enough then it is very easy to click frame-by-frame snapshots (green arrow) from the video for example for making gifs. :D

EDIT: later i have learned that the video can be watched frame-by-frame by clicking the right-most button (the button with red squary with blue frames) on the left row of buttons, where the green arrow is pointing. this can't be repeated very many times without VLC getting stuck, but if one takes snapshots of the frames then it can be repeated rather many times.

Image

if you click on the little double arrows (below the slider) to the left the speed will become exactly 2/3, 1/2, 1/3, and 1/4 of normal. clicking the double arrow on the right will increase speed to 3/2, 2, 3 and 4 times faster. clicking the center "1x" will reset the speed to normal.

Imagegif criar

this hint is for VLC-users but i suppose there are similar replay controls in other players, too.
